The church of Salonnes has a rich history dating back to the 8th century, when it was built to house the relics of Saint-Privat and Saint-Hilaire. After being destroyed during conflicts over the salt mines and later the Thirty Years' War, it was rebuilt in 1540 and again in 1750. The most striking element is the Gothic portal, which is the only original part from the 16th century to have been preserved. Made of Jaumont stone, it features an accolade arcade flanked by pinnacles. Three Gothic niches above the double doors recall the ornate style of the late Gothic period.

The Saar Coal Canal at Trois Ports immerses you in a peaceful landscape where the waterways meander through lush vegetation and peaceful countryside. Along the canal you will come across old locks and charming ports, each with a rich history linked to the coal trade which was once a thriving industry.

The parish church of Saint-Privat, which at first glance looks ugly because of the concrete that covers its walls, is full of treasures. Built in the 8th century, it has been remodeled over time but retains a magnificent, finely crafted Gothic portal. Its ornaments representing various animals and plants give it a unique appearance. If you go through Salonnes, stop at the church!

Frequently Asked Questions

How many mountain bike trails are available around Juvelize?

There are over 10 mountain bike trails around Juvelize, offering a variety of experiences. The region is part of an extensive network of well-maintained cycle routes in the broader Moselle area.

What are the difficulty levels of mountain bike trails in Juvelize?

The trails around Juvelize cater to various skill levels. You'll find 3 easy routes and 9 moderate routes. There are no difficult trails listed in the immediate area, making it suitable for a wide range of riders.

What kind of terrain can I expect when mountain biking in Juvelize?

Juvelize offers diverse terrain, including hills and plateaus, within the beautiful Lorraine Regional Natural Park. You can expect to ride through calm forests, local countryside, and protected natural reserves. The broader Moselle region also features scenic river valleys and vineyards.

Are there any circular mountain bike routes in Juvelize?

Yes, many routes around Juvelize are circular. For example, you can try the Mountainbike loop from Dieuze, a 25.5-mile moderate trail, or the Étang de Wuisse loop from Dieuze, which is 20.1 miles and circles the Étang de Wuisse.

Are there family-friendly mountain bike routes in Juvelize?

While specific 'family-friendly' designations aren't always available, the region offers 3 easy mountain bike routes that could be suitable for families. The diverse terrain and extensive network mean you can often find paths that match various skill levels, including less challenging options.

Are there mountain bike trails that pass by water features or lakes?

Yes, several routes incorporate water features. The Étang de Wuisse loop from Dieuze circles the Étang de Wuisse. Another option is the Kerprich-aux-Bois lock – Étang du Stock loop from Dieuze, which passes by the Étang du Stock.

What are some interesting places or landmarks to see along the mountain bike trails?

You can explore various points of interest. The Church of St Privat de Salonnes – Imperial Station of Chambrey loop from Vic-sur-Seille leads through historical sites. Other notable attractions in the wider area include the Marne–Rhine Canal, the historic town of Marsal, and the picturesque Lindre Pond.
